ROTTERDAM. Sparta Rotterdam overcomes Fortuna Sittard 3-1. Sparta Rotterdam got an early 2-0 lead with 2 goals from B. Smeets (21′) and L. Thy (29′). Fortuna Sittard tried to recover with a goal from M. Seuntjens (49′). However, the match was closed by a goal (73′) scored by E. Emegha for Sparta Rotterdam. Fortuna Sittard lost this match even if it was superior in terms of ball possession (57%).
The match was played at the Sparta-Stadion Het Kasteel stadium in Rotterdam on Sunday and it started at 12:30 pm local time. In front of 6,623 spectators. The referee was Erwin Blank with the help of Cristian Dobre and Freek Vandeursen. The 4th official was Nick Smit. The weather was cloudy. The temperature was pleasant at 21.2 degrees Celsius or 70.09 Fahrenheit. The humidity was 66%.
Sparta Rotterdam started with a 4-2-3-1 line-up (4-2-3-1). On the other side, Fortuna Sittard adopted a aggressive formation (4-3-3).
